- =head1 NAME
- Bio::Pipeline::Method
- =head1 SYNOPSIS
- use Bio::Pipeline::Method;
- my $data_handler = Bio::Pipeline::Method->new(-dbid=>1,
- -method=>"fetch_by_dbID",
- -argument=>\@arguments,
- -rank=>1);
- =head1 DESCRIPTION
- Methods specifiy the adaptor methods and the correspoding arguments
- needed by a IO to fetch or store output. The rank represents the
- order in which they are called by IOHandler methods fetch_input,
- write_output

- package Bio::Pipeline::Method;
- use vars qw(@ISA);
- use strict;
- use Bio::Root::Root;
- @ISA = qw(Bio::Root::Root);
- =head1 Constructors
- =head2 new
- Title : new
- Usage : my $data_handler = Bio::Pipeline::Method->new(-dbid=>1,
- -method=>"fetch_by_dbID",
- -argument=>\@arguments,
- -rank=>1);
- Function: this constructor should only be used in the IO_adaptor or IO objects.
- generates a new Bio::Pipeline::Method
- Returns : a new Method object
- Args :
- =cut
- sub new {
- my($class,@args) = @_;
- my $self = $class->SUPER::new(@args);
- my ($dbID,$name,$argument,$rank)=$self->_rearrange([qw( DBID
- NAME
- ARGUMENT
- RANK)],@args);
- $name || $self->throw("Method needs a method arg.");
- $dbID && $self->dbID($dbID);
- $self->{'_name'} = $name;
- $self->{'_argument'} = $argument;
- $self->{'_rank'} = $rank;
- return $self;
- }
